Abstract
The fine structures of conidia of Cochliobolus miyabeanus were investigated by electron microscopic observations of ultrathin sections of conidia fixed in a solution of 2per cent permanganate buffered with veronal acetate to pH 7.4 and the results were shown in Figs. 1∼7.
Fig. 1. General view of a conidium. The conidium was cut parallely to the long axis of cell.
Fig. 2. Higher magnification of a small area (cf. rectangle in Fig. 1). Note the different orientation of cellulose microfibrils in outer and inner layers.
Fig. 3. Various profiles of mitochondria and endoplasmic reticulum.
Fig. 4. General view of nuclear area.
Fig. 5. Portion of protoplasmic junction. The junction was cut parallely to the long axis of the cell.
Fig. 6. Portion of protoplasmic junction. The junction was cut perpendicularly to the long axis of cell.
Fig. 7. Diagrammatic view of conidium of Cochliobolus miyabeanus reconstructed from the data obtained.
